      <![CDATA[<p>Hi!  I have a failing external hard drive that I want to give to a local computer recycling center. I want to do this safely and I'm wondering if I can use a bulk eraser - the kind that radio stations used to use to erase reels of audio tape?  Thanks.<br />
<div class="leocomment">I wouldn't. The hard disk media is more protected - by its case if nothing else - than bulk audio tape. Those magnets are still not strong enough to penetrate the case and layers of platters in the drive.<br />

      <![CDATA[<p>What about encrypting the data? then I would think it could (in many cases) become an impossible task to decrypt the data, from the partly recovered data you get from the drive.<br />
<div class="leocomment">As long a you've chosen a strong pass<em>phrase</em>, and as long as you're certain that the <em>un</em>encrypted data was never temporarily outside of your encrypted container (like, say, the Windows swap file or a temporary file) then yes, encryption could be a viable solution.<br /><br />
Specifically I think if you used whole drive encryption from day one on the drive you might be ok.<br /><br />
But if you're suggesting to encrypt just prior to disposal, I'd just format instead. Or break out my drill press. :-)<br /><br />

      <![CDATA[<p>With regards to using magnets to erase your files.  Even if you have a powerful degausser, if you want to give the drive away or have it usable afterwards, don't use a magnet.  The manufacturer stores important data on the disk for the drive itself to function.  Erasing that will render the drive unusable.</p>

<p>Also, it takes a strong magnetic field inside the drive to actually erase the data on the disk.  Even magnets that you or I consider very strong typically don't project the magnetic field strongly enough far away from it's surface.  And by far away, I mean about half an inch.</p>]]>

      <![CDATA[<p>IBM has a free (Anyone can download and use it) software program that you can download from their website called "IBM(R) Secure Data Disposal (SDD) Version 1.2.".  It runs from a boot disk/CD, and a will wipe out your drive by copying, sectory by sector, track by track, random data onto the hard drive.  It will overwrite everything that is there, as many times as you want.  So there would be no chance of someone every reading what was on your disk drive.<br />
Caveat - doesn't work with RAID systems very well, since it needs drivers to read them.</p>

      <![CDATA[<p>Both 'DriveScrubber' and 'KillDisk' have functional demos for download- the file you download creates a bootable floppy disk that will overwrite the entire surface of whatever drive you choose-erasing data, partitions, etc. You would then have to create and format a new partition. It would take special hardware to retrieve any data after that. Takes about 2-1/2 minutes per GB on an average HD/machine.</p>]]>

      <![CDATA[<p>Yes, there are various utilities out there that will do varying degrees of data "wiping" to help decrease the chances that the data can be recovered. And if an unconditional Format isn't enough for you, then they might be worth checking out. But remember that there are few guarantees ... they only decrease the probability of recovery, not neccessarily eliminate it. Format takes care of the 99% case ... the rest of you need to decide how much trouble you want to take.</p>]]>
